人工智能(AI)在单位转换方面的应用可以极大提高转换过程的效率和准确性。实现单位转换的无缝切换,需要结合机器学习、自然语言处理(NLP)、数据挖掘和计算机视觉等技术。以下是如何利用AI实现单位转换无缝切换的详细步骤:
1. 数据采集与预处理
首先,需要收集大量不同单位之间的转换数据,包括历史数据、实时数据以及未来可能使用的单位转换信息。这些数据可以通过API接口获取,或者从现有的数据库中提取。
数据处理:
- 清洗:去除重复项、错误数据、无关信息等。
- 标注:为每个单位的转换规则进行标注,例如将“千克”转换成“磅”时,需要知道“1千克 = 2.20462磅”。
2. 特征工程
基于上述数据,通过特征提取来表示每个单位转换的规则。这通常涉及统计和机器学习方法,如决策树、支持向量机或神经网络,以识别不同单位之间的转换模式。
3. 模型训练
使用已标注的数据训练一个分类器或回归模型,该模型能够根据输入的单位预测出相应的转换值。可以使用深度学习框架,如TensorFlow或PyTorch,来构建和训练复杂的模型。
4. 模型评估
在独立的测试集上评估模型的性能,确保其准确率和召回率满足需求。可以使用交叉验证等技术来避免过拟合。
5. 实时转换
开发一个实时更新的系统,该系统能够根据最新的数据源不断调整模型。这要求系统具备一定的自学习能力,能够在没有人工干预的情况下自我优化。
6. 用户界面设计
开发友好的用户界面,使得用户可以方便地输入需要转换的单位,并看到即时的转换结果。这可能需要图形用户界面(GUI)设计,以适应不同的设备和操作习惯。
7. 系统集成与部署
将AI转换系统集成到现有的IT基础设施中,确保它可以稳定运行,并且与其他系统(如ERP、CRM等)有良好的兼容性。
8. 反馈与迭代
收集用户的反馈,并根据实际使用情况对系统进行调整和优化。持续迭代是确保系统长期有效的关键。
通过上述步骤,可以建立一个高效、准确的单位转换AI系统,实现无缝切换和自动化转换功能。这不仅可以提高企业的运营效率,还可以减少人为错误,提升企业的整体竞争力。